Abstract
The invention discloses an automobile fault diagnosis indicating system and a method. The automobile fault diagnosis indicating method comprises the following steps that: S1, an electronic control unit acquires automobile fault diagnosis information and converts the automobile fault diagnosis information into a network signal; S2, a hardware communication module acquires the network signal from the electronic control unit and performs data conversion on the network signal; and S3, a data analysis module performs analysis processing on data from the hardware communication module and indicates the analyzed data. By the automobile fault diagnosis indicating system and the automobile fault diagnosis indicating method, network peer linkage between the electronic control unit and the hardware communication module is established; fault diagnosis data information in the electronic control unit is read and is analyzed by the data analysis module; and the information is indicated on a multimedia terminal in the form of sound, word or image. By the automobile fault diagnosis indicating system and the automobile fault diagnosis indicating method, the multimedia terminal and the electronic control unit of an automobile are effectively combined, so that an automobile fault and data display function of the multimedia terminal is realized; the utilization rate of the multimedia terminal of the automobile is increased; and the efficiency of reading the diagnosis information of the electronic control unit is improved.

See also shown in Figure 1ly, Fig. 1 is system principle diagram of the present invention.The present invention is to provide a kind of automobile failure diagnosis prompt system, being mainly used in solving present automobile fault information need to be by the problem that specialized equipment just can read and the car multimedia termination function is single, utilization ratio is lower.
Wherein native system includes and comprises electronic control unit and the multimedia terminal that is installed in the automobile, described electronic control unit is comprised of large scale integrated circuits such as microprocessor, CPU, storer, ROM, RAM, input/output interface I/O, modulus converter A/D and shaping, drivings, it is mainly used in the state of monitoring vehicle, diagnosing malfunction to automobile, obtain diagnostic message, and the storage automobile fault information; The multimedia terminal is the automobile display alarm equipment with sound and visual screen, includes car audio system, Vehicular navigation system, reverse radar system etc.
Wherein also include in this system: network physical connector, hardware communication module, data analysis module and wireless communication module.The network physical connector is used for foundation and links with the network between the electronic control unit is reciprocity, and therefrom draws foldback circuit; Hardware communication module one end is connected with the network physical connector, is used for obtaining the network signal from electronic control unit, and this network signal is carried out data-switching, and the other end then is connected with data analysis module; Data analysis module, be used for the data analysis from the hardware communication module is processed, and the data after will processing send to the multimedia terminal and point out, or the wireless communication module (GPRS module) by being connected with data analysis module, the data correspondence that data analysis module is processed sends to the remote vehicle monitor terminal, carries out remote monitoring.
Wherein said hardware communication module need to meet ISO 9141-2, K/Llins,, SAE-J1850 VPW, SAE-J1850 PWM, CAN ISO 11898 ISO15765-4, at a high speed, the vehicle network communication module physics requirement such as middling speed and low speed CAN.Data analysis module requires to be the chip (have ARM7 or M3 processor) of processing power more than 60MHz, and the hardware system that can carry out data analysis.
If above-mentioned multimedia terminal has enough processing poweies, also can directly use the process chip of multimedia terminal to replace data analysis module; If data analysis module is different from the multimedia terminal process chip, both can utilize wired (such as UART, LIN network) or modes such as wireless (Wifi, bluetooths) to carry out communication to connect alternately.
Native system is with data or the vehicle trouble information of automobile, show and remind in the car multimedia terminal with the form of sound, literal or image, realized that the user quick and precisely reads automobile fault information, increase simultaneously vehicle failure and the data display function of multimedia terminal, improved the utilization factor of multimedia terminal; Avoided automobile fault information to be stored in the storer of ECU own, the problem that need to just can read by the equipment of special use.
